The CommandPlacements element groups CommandPlacement elements and other CommandPlacements groupings.
The CommandPlacements element is optional. If no commands, groups, or menus must be included in a secondary location, you do not have to include this section in your .vsct file.
<CommandPlacements>
<CommandPlacement>... </CommandPlacement>
<CommandPlacement>... </CommandPlacement>
</CommandPlacements>

Example
<CommandPlacements>
<CommandPlacement guid="guidWidgetPackage" id="cmdidInsertOptions"
priority="0x0300">
<Parent guid="cmdGuidWidgetCommands" id="menuIDEditWidget"/>
</CommandPlacement>
</CommandPlacements>
